Birgunj Customs Sees Significant Rise in Exports Over Seven Months
Summary
Birgunj customs point recorded NPR 66.48 billion in exports during the first seven months of the fiscal year, showing an increase of NPR 9.94 billion compared to last year.
Key Points
- Exports through Birgunj customs reached NPR 66.48 billion in the first seven months of the current fiscal year.
- This represents an increase of NPR 9.94 billion compared to the same period last fiscal year.
- Processed soybean oil was the top export product worth NPR 35.58 billion.
- Imports through Birgunj increased by 11 percent to NPR 595.46 billion in the first five months of the current fiscal year.
